01Plan your outfits
- Before you start packing, plan your outfits for each day of your trip. This will help you avoid overpacking and ensure that you have enough clothes for each day.
- Choose versatile pieces that can be mixed and matched to create different outfits. Stick to a neutral color palette to easily coordinate your clothes.
- Consider the weather at your destination and pack accordingly. Check the forecast to determine if you need to pack any specific items like a rain jacket or a sweater.
02Roll your clothes
- Rolling your clothes instead of folding them can save a lot of space in your carry-on. It also helps prevent wrinkles and keeps your clothes organized.
- Start with heavier items like jeans and sweaters as a base at the bottom of your bag. Then roll lighter items like t-shirts and dresses on top.
- Use packing cubes or compression bags to further maximize space and keep similar items together.
03Pack travel-sized toiletries
- To save space and comply with airline regulations, pack travel-sized toiletries or transfer your favorite products into reusable travel containers.
- Opt for solid toiletries like shampoo bars and solid perfume to avoid any liquid restrictions or leaks.
- Pack any essential medications in your carry-on bag, along with a small first aid kit.
04Utilize empty spaces
- Make use of any empty spaces in your carry-on, such as the inside of shoes.
- Roll up socks, underwear, and accessories and tuck them into shoes to save space and keep everything organized.
- Take advantage of pockets and compartments in your bag to store small items like chargers, adapters, and sunglasses.
05Wear your bulkiest items
- To save even more space in your carry-on, wear your bulkiest items on the plane.
- If you're traveling to a colder destination, wear your coat, boots, and heaviest sweater instead of packing them.
- Not only does this free up space in your bag, but it also keeps you warm and comfortable during your journey.
